The journey towards managing Attention Deficit Hyperactivity Disorder (ADHD) frequently includes pharmacological intervention. Nevertheless, finding the right medication and dosage is not a one-size-fits-all process. This duration of adjustment, referred to as titration, is a critical phase where doctor thoroughly increase or decrease a patient's dosage to discover the "healing window"-- the point where symptoms are managed with the fewest possible adverse effects.

While titration is an essential step toward clinical stability, it is often accompanied by a range of side effects. Understanding what to expect, how to keep an eye on changes, and when to seek medical recommendations can significantly enhance the client experience and treatment results.


What is ADHD Titration?

Titration is the scientific procedure of finding the optimum dose of a medication. In the context of ADHD, this normally includes starting at the lowest possible dose of a stimulant (such as Methylphenidate or Lisdexamfetamine) or a non-stimulant (such as Atomoxetine) and slowly increasing it.

The objective of titration is two-fold:

  1. Maximize Efficacy: Reducing signs like impulsivity, hyperactivity, and inattention.
  2. Reduce Toxicity: Ensuring the adverse effects do not outweigh the advantages of the medication.

During this several-week or several-month process, the brain and body need to adapt to altered levels of neurotransmitters like dopamine and norepinephrine. It is during this adjustment duration that negative effects are most common.


Typical Side Effects During Titration

Adverse effects vary depending on the class of medication prescribed. Stimulants are the most typical first-line treatment, however non-stimulants are frequently used for patients who do not endure stimulants well.

Stimulant Medications

Stimulants work by increasing the accessibility of particular chemicals in the brain. Due to the fact that these chemicals likewise affect the main nervous system, physical side effects are common.

  • Appetite Suppression: Perhaps the most typical side impact, numerous patients find they have little interest in food throughout the hours the medication is active.
  • Sleeping Disorders and Sleep Disturbances: Because stimulants promote awareness, taking them too late in the day can hinder the capability to go to sleep.
  • Increased Heart Rate or Blood Pressure: Stimulants are vasoconstrictors, which can result in a small increase in cardiovascular metrics.
  • The "Crash": As the medication wears away, individuals might experience a sudden dip in state of mind or energy, typically described as rebound symptoms.

Non-Stimulant Medications

Non-stimulants work in a different way, frequently taking numerous weeks to build up in the system. Their adverse effects tend to be more intestinal or sedative in nature.

  • Sleepiness: Unlike stimulants, medications like Guanfacine can cause considerable fatigue.
  • Queasiness and Stomach Ache: Often experienced when the medication is first presented.
  • Dry Mouth: A common systemic reaction to non-stimulant ADHD treatments.

The "Titration Curve": What to Expect

Titration is seldom a linear course. Patients might feel exceptional on a low dosage for a week, then experience a surge in negative effects when the dosage is increased. Healthcare suppliers usually utilize a schedule to monitor these shifts.

Handling Side Effects: Practical Strategies

While many adverse effects are temporary, they can be disruptive to every day life. Clients and caretakers can use a number of methods to reduce these problems during the titration phase.

Nutritional Adjustments

  • Eat Before the Dose: For those experiencing cravings suppression, consuming a high-protein breakfast before taking the medication can guarantee calorie consumption for the day.
  • Hydration: Many ADHD medications cause dehydration or dry mouth. Bring a water bottle is important.
  • Vitamin C Timing: Some studies suggest that high doses of Vitamin C (ascorbic acid) can disrupt the absorption of specific stimulants. It is often advised to prevent orange juice or Vitamin C supplements an hour before and after taking medication.

Sleep Hygiene

  • Timing: Stimulants must be taken as early as possible. For long-acting medications, taking them after 10:00 AM might lead to late-night wakefulness.
  • Wind-down Routine: Implementing a rigorous digital detox and relaxation routine in the night can help neutralize the lingering alertness of the medication.

Monitoring Tools

Clients are encouraged to keep a "Titration Journal." This ought to consist of:

  • The time the dose was taken.
  • A rating of sign control (1-- 10).
  • A list of any physical or psychological adverse effects.
  • The time the medication felt like it "diminished."

When to Contact a Healthcare Professional

While moderate headaches or a dry mouth are expected, particular "red flag" symptoms need immediate medical intervention. If a client experiences any of the following, they ought to call their physician or emergency services:

  1. Chest Pain or Shortness of Breath: Any signs of cardiovascular distress.
  2. Extreme Mental Health Changes: This consists of self-destructive ideation, hallucinations, or extreme paranoia.
  3. Allergic Reactions: Swelling of the tongue, hives, or problem swallowing.
  4. Fainting or Syncope: Significant drops in blood pressure or heart rate irregularities.

FREQUENTLY ASKED QUESTION: Frequently Asked Questions about ADHD Titration

1. The length of time does the titration procedure typically take?

The process typically lasts in between 4 to 12 weeks. It depends on how rapidly the client responds to the medication and the presence of adverse effects.

2. Is it normal to feel "robotic" on ADHD medication?

This is frequently referred to as "emotional blunting." While it can take place during titration, it is normally an indication that the dose is too high. The objective of titration is to help a client focus, not to change their character.

3. Can I skip doses on weekends throughout titration?

It is vital to follow the prescriber's guidelines. During titration, consistency is key to determining how the body responds to the dosage. Avoiding dosages can skew the information and extend the titration process.

4. Why do my side results seem worse in the afternoon?

For stimulant users, this is often the "rebound effect." As the medication leaves the system, ADHD symptoms may return more extremely, accompanied by irritation or tiredness. This frequently signifies that the shipment approach (e.g., immediate release vs. extended release) needs modification.

5. Do adverse effects ever disappear?

Yes. Numerous adverse effects, such as moderate headaches, queasiness, and jitters, typically diminish within the first two weeks of remaining on a constant dose as the body develops a tolerance to the side effects while maintaining the restorative advantages.
